/**
* Stream a JSON array to disk without holding it all in memory.
*/
function createJsonArrayWriter(jsonPath) {
const stream = fs.createWriteStream(jsonPath, { flags: 'w' })
stream.write('[\n')
let wroteAny = false
function write(value) {
const serialized = JSON.stringify(value, null, 2)
if (wroteAny) stream.write(',\n')
stream.write(serialized)
wroteAny = true
}
async function close() {
stream.write('\n]\n')
stream.end()
await new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
stream.on('finish', resolve)
stream.on('error', reject)
})
}
return { write, close }
}
